#15267: automaton: iterator over words of language
-------------------------------------+-------------------------------------
Reporter: dkrenn | Owner:
Type: enhancement | Status: needs_review
Priority: major | Milestone: sage-6.7
Component: finite state | Resolution:
machines | Merged in:
Keywords: automata, finite | Reviewers: Clemens Heuberger
state machines, language, | Work issues:
iterator, automatic sequences, | Commit:
sd66 | 7c9a1647aa60f71b7553c816d4b1993306dc47c2
Authors: Daniel Krenn | Stopgaps:
Report Upstream: N/A |
Branch: |
u/dkrenn/fsm/languages |
Dependencies: #15078, #18114, |
#18118 |
-------------------------------------+-------------------------------------
Changes (by dkrenn):
* status: needs_work => needs_review
* commit: e439bf224272bf353852425e642ba598fe9bad0a =>
7c9a1647aa60f71b7553c816d4b1993306dc47c2
Comment:
Replying to [comment:14 cheuberg]:
> * please cross-review reviewer patch.
Done; looks ok.
> * documentation of the parameter `write_in_every_step` is unclear in all
occurrences: what does "the output is stored" mean? It seems that it means
that instead of processing the input word, all prefixes of the input word
are processed.
Renamed and rewritten.
> * parameter `process_iterator_class`: the consequences of setting this
parameter are not explained.
Explained.
> * `_FSMProcessIteratorAll_`: "but only accepts": remove "only"?
Done.
----
New commits:
||[http://git.sagemath.org/sage.git/commit/?id=6e47b1d65589662ee492c69763199677790acb35
6e47b1d]||{{{minor rephrase doc: remove one "only"}}}||
||[http://git.sagemath.org/sage.git/commit/?id=80d8798ab61d3f7941325095701872589ebecf45
80d8798]||{{{rename write_in_every_step and rephrase doc}}}||
||[http://git.sagemath.org/sage.git/commit/?id=7c9a1647aa60f71b7553c816d4b1993306dc47c2
7c9a164]||{{{rephrase/extend doc of process_iterator_class}}}||
--
Ticket URL: <http://trac.sagemath.org/ticket/15267#comment:18>
Sage <http://www.sagemath.org>
Sage: Creating a Viable Open Source Alternative to Magma, Maple, Mathematica,
and MATLAB
--
You received this message because you are subscribed to the Google Groups
"sage-trac" group.
To unsubscribe from this group and stop receiving emails from it, send an email
to [email protected].
To post to this group, send email to [email protected].
Visit this group at http://groups.google.com/group/sage-trac.
For more options, visit https://groups.google.com/d/optout.